Check Agricultural Market Prices Online

With over 70 percent of the population living in rural areas, India's economic growth significantly depends on the health of the agriculture sector. The ongoing process of globalisation and economic liberalisation has induced a paradigm shift in the field of Agricultural Marketing.

To make farming communities benefit from the new global market access opportunities, the internal agricultural marketing system of the country is being integrated and strengthened. Various studies reveal that farmers, on an average, get a reasonably higher price by selling their produce in the regulated markets (Agricultural Produce Market Committees - APMCs) compared to rural, village and unregulated wholesale markets.


The Directorate of Marketing and Inspection (DMI) is successfully running an ICT project: NICNET based Agricultural Marketing Information System Network (AGMARKNET) in the country, for linking all important APMCs (Agricultural Produce Market Committees), State Agricultural Marketing Boards/ Directorates and DMI regional offices located throughout the country, for effective information exchange on market prices. National Informatics Centre (NIC) is the ICT agency behind the implementation of the Project.
